About D60 Online School

D60 Online School is a middle school located in the heart of Pueblo, Colorado. The school serves students from fifth to eighth grade and has an enrollment of 115 students. With a student-teacher ratio of 23:1, D60 Online School provides personalized learning opportunities for its students.

There are five full-time equivalent teachers dedicated to supporting the educational needs of the middle schoolers. The academic performance at D60 Online School currently ranks in the lower percentile among Colorado schools, with only 19% of students proficient or above in English Language Arts and Reading, and just 4% meeting proficiency standards in math. Despite these challenges, the school is committed to fostering student development and growth, focusing on creating a supportive learning environment.

D60 Online School sits within a mid-size city setting, providing its students with access to urban resources while still offering a tailored educational experience.

What Parents Should Know

With an enrollment of 115 students, D60 Online School is a smaller school where families often find a close-knit community atmosphere. Smaller settings can mean more individual attention from teachers and staff, though they may offer fewer extracurricular options than larger schools.

The student-teacher ratio at D60 Online School is 23:1, which is higher than the national average. This may mean larger class sizes, so parents should ask about classroom support, teaching assistants, and how the school differentiates instruction for students who need extra help.

D60 Online School is a virtual school, meaning instruction is delivered primarily online. Virtual schools offer flexibility but require strong self-discipline and a reliable home learning environment. Parents should consider whether their child thrives with independent, technology-based learning and ask about the school's approach to student engagement and support.

Community Profile

The community surrounding D60 Online School has a median household income of $67,500. It is an area where 26%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$282,100, with a median rent of $990/month. The area has a poverty rate of 10.8%. The average commute for residents is 20 minutes.
